Hamperley Hideaways
No availability at present on Pitchup.com- Nearly wild site at the foot of The Long Mynd in the Shropshire Hills
- Ten minutes’ drive to Stokesay Castle, and 25 minutes to Ludlow
- Picnic benches, firepits and composting loos; shops 10 minutes’ drive

- This park has no on-site shower facilities.
- Under 18s must be accompanied by their parents or legal guardians.
- The campground/park does not accept breeds/crossbreeds listed in the Breed-specific legislation (i.e. Pit Bull Terrier, Japanese Tosa, Dogo Argentino, and Fila Brasileiro) and/or any of the following: Staffordshire bull terrier, American Staffordshire terrier, Rottweiler, any Mastiff or Tosa.
- Group bookings of 2 or more units (e.g. tent, caravan, RV or accommodation hire) traveling together are not permitted via Pitchup.com.
- Group bookings of 6 or more adults are not permitted (couples and immediate family members excepted).
- No bachelor/bachelorette parties permitted via Pitchup.com.
- No cars/motorcycles at the site. All cars must be parked in the designated area.
- At least one of the party members must be aged 18 or over.
- This is a quiet park: no music is allowed.
- Guests are advised to bring a good quality flashlight with them as parts of the park are unlit.
- No naked flames are allowed inside the hired accommodation units.
- There are no garbage cans onsite: all garbage will need to be taken home with you.
- Please note that the toilet facilities are unisex.
